#a9c06e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9c06e is composed of 66.3% red, 75.3%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 76.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#a9c06e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#538100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a9c06e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a9c06e has RGB values of R:169, G:192,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11124846.

Shades and Tints of #a9c06e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fafb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a9c06e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979896 is the less saturated color, while #c2f836 is the most saturated one.
